Towards Designing User Interfaces on Mobile Touch- screen Devices for People with Visual Impairment

Although touch screens have great input flexibility, they are largely inaccessible to people with visual impairment. One of the issues with touch screens is the lack of clear tactile feedback, which is critical for visually-impaired people. We developed SemFeel, a tactile feedback technology that can express some semantic information by using multiple vibration motors in concert. We believe that the rich tactile feedback offered by SemFeel enables people with visual impairment to better use mobile touch-screen devices. In this paper, we report our findings from semi-structured interviews with three participants who have visual impairment about their experience of mobile devices. We then discuss a gesture-based user interface with tactile feedback for people with visual impairment.
